Ten Lectures on Wavelets

Chapter 10: Generalizations and Tricks for Orthonormal Wavelet Bases

This chapter consists of several generalizations and extensions of earlier constructions. These are not treated with the same detail as in the previous chapters. Some of the topics are still developing, and I expect that any write-up on them would look very different even two years from now. The sections cover multi-dimensional wavelets with dilation factor 2, via tensor product multiresolution analysis, or via nonseparable schemes; orthonormal wavelet bases with dilation factor different from 2, integer or non-integer; the "splitting trick" for better frequency resolution (in fact, merely a special case of the "wavelet packets" of Coifman and Meyer); wavelet bases on an interval.

10.1. Multidimensional wavelet bases with dilation factor 2.

For simplicity, we will consider only the two-dimensional case; higher dimensions are analogous. One trivial way of constructing an orthonormal basis for , starting from an orthonormal wavelet basis ? j,k( x) = 2 ? j/2 ?(2 j x ? k) for , is simply to take the tensor product functions generated by two one-dimensional bases:

The resulting functions are indeed wavelets, and is an orthonormal basis for . In this basis the two variables x 1 and x 2 are dilated separately.

There exists another construction, more interesting for many applications, in which the dilations of the resulting orthonormal wavelet basis control both variables simultaneously.
